A tool designed to compute grade point averages, specifically tailored for use by students attending a particular university in Pennsylvania, allows for the estimation of cumulative academic performance. This resource typically accepts letter grades and corresponding credit hours for each course, processing this data to provide a numerical representation of a student’s overall standing. For example, a student might input an ‘A’ in a 3-credit course and a ‘B’ in a 4-credit course, and the calculator determines the GPA based on that institution’s grading scale.

The availability of such a calculation method offers several advantages, including facilitating academic planning, monitoring progress toward graduation requirements, and providing a clear benchmark for scholarship eligibility. Historically, these calculations were performed manually, a time-consuming and potentially error-prone process. The advent of digital tools offers an efficient and accurate alternative, empowering students to proactively manage their academic trajectories.

  • Repeated Courses

    The institutional policy regarding repeated courses significantly impacts GPA calculation. Some universities calculate GPA based on the latest attempt, while others average all attempts. The calculator must be programmed to reflect this specific policy to provide an accurate reflection of a student’s academic record, particularly in cases where a course has been taken multiple times.

  • Weighting of Grades

    Credit hours function as multipliers in the GPA calculation. A course carrying more credit hours exerts a greater influence on the final GPA than a course with fewer credit hours. For example, an ‘A’ in a 4-credit course will have a more significant positive impact on the GPA than an ‘A’ in a 1-credit course. Errors in credit hour entry directly skew the weighted average, leading to inaccurate reflections of academic performance.

  • Weighted Average Calculation

    GPA calculation is a weighted average, where each course’s grade value is weighted by the number of credit hours assigned to that course. The algorithm multiplies the numerical grade value by the credit hours for each course, sums these products, and then divides by the total number of credit hours. For example, if a student earns an ‘A’ (4.0) in a 3-credit course and a ‘B’ (3.0) in a 4-credit course, the calculation would be ((4.0 3) + (3.0 4)) / (3 + 4) = 3.43. Inaccurate credit hour information and its handling will negatively impact the final GPA result.

The cumulative GPA result produced by a Kutztown University calculation method serves as a key metric for various academic purposes. It is a primary factor in determining eligibility for academic honors such as Dean’s List or graduation with honors (cum laude, magna cum laude, summa cum laude). Scholarship eligibility is also frequently tied to a minimum GPA requirement. Moreover, some academic departments within the university may use GPA thresholds for admission into specific programs or for participation in research opportunities. As such, the cumulative GPA result, as determined by the calculation resource, is a central component of a students academic profile and prospects.

Question 1: How does the grade point average calculation tool incorporate Kutztown University’s grading scale?

The calculation tool is programmed with the official Kutztown University grading scale, which assigns numerical values to letter grades (e.g., A = 4.0, B+ = 3.3, C = 2.0). These values are used to compute the weighted average of a student’s grades. Any deviation from this scale within the tool would result in an inaccurate GPA calculation.

Question 2: What is the impact of repeated courses on the grade point average calculation according to Kutztown University policy?

Kutztown University’s policy dictates that only the most recent grade earned in a repeated course is factored into the cumulative GPA. The calculation tool is designed to reflect this policy, disregarding earlier attempts of a course when calculating the overall GPA. Course repetition is handled accordingly.

Question 3: Are courses taken on a pass/fail basis included in the grade point average calculation?

Courses taken on a pass/fail basis are generally excluded from the GPA calculation, as they do not receive letter grades. These courses contribute towards earned credit hours but do not affect the cumulative GPA. The calculation tool is configured to recognize and exclude these courses from the GPA computation.

Question 4: How are transfer credits from other institutions factored into the grade point average?

Transfer credits accepted by Kutztown University contribute toward total earned credit hours. However, grades earned in transfer courses are not typically factored into the Kutztown University GPA. The calculation tool accounts for transfer credits by including the credit hours but excluding the associated grades from other institutions.

Question 5: What is the appropriate course of action if a discrepancy is noted between the grade point average calculated by the tool and the official transcript?

Should a discrepancy occur, students should consult their official transcript as the definitive record of academic performance. If the discrepancy persists, contacting the university registrar’s office is recommended to investigate potential errors in the official record or calculation tool.
